02 N.C. Admin. Code 61 .0101 - DEFINITIONS
The following definitions shall apply throughout the rules of this Chapter:
(1) "Chemical Method"
means a process accomplished by application of a disinfectant registered by the
U.S. Environmental Protection Agency under 7 U.S.C. Chapter 125 SEC. 3. [136a]
of the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act, and labeled as a
disinfectant for bedding.
(2)
"Chief Financial Officer" means the officer or employee with primary
bookkeeping responsibility for a business that manufactures, sanitizes, sells,
or offers to sell bedding in this State.
(3) "Division" means the Structural Pest
Control and Pesticides Division of the N.C. Department of Agriculture and
Consumer Services.
(4) "Dry Heat
Method" means a process accomplished by conduction, where heat is absorbed by
the exterior surface of an item and then passed inward to the next
layer.
(5) "Person" means an
individual, corporation, company, partnership, or other legal entity.
